Output e952107e4ffb1b08a3fdaef79e2c1ceeba5694a56ddb0de524485dfd6f8d52b9:25

value
99203
script pubkey
OP_0 OP_PUSHBYTES_20 fb07d22fa9cbfaec7641e7c46ba90790fca467d4
address
bc1qlvraytafe0awcajpulzxh2g8jr72ge75ymunej
transaction
e952107e4ffb1b08a3fdaef79e2c1ceeba5694a56ddb0de524485dfd6f8d52b9
confirmations
103666
spent
true